1. Define the geography before comparing reputation
Cary is recorded as a municipality in North Carolina. The 2020–2024 ACS five-year estimate records 179,306 residents, with a margin of error of 190, and identifies relationships with Chatham County, Durham County, and Wake County. That population figure is context for planning coverage; it does not establish demand for legal services, review volume, competition, calls, cases, or revenue. A firm serving Cary may also serve clients across one or more of those counties, but the correct review audience depends on the firm’s actual service area and client records.
